HOT Kendra Wilkinson is trending today

This is due recent interview about her Talks about Sex with Hugh Hefner: She Was 18, He Was 78.Appearing on the U.K.'s I'm a Celebrity, Get Me Out of Here!, Kendra on Top star Kendra Wilkinson was asked if, as one of Hugh Hefner's Girls Next Door, she had to have sex with the Playboy mogul. And how did she end up at the Playboy Mansion in the first place?


http://trendingcelebrityscandalsupdate.blogspot.com


"I just wanted to party. And I had a damn good time. It was so much fun," Wilkinson, 29, told TV presenter-model Melanie Sykes. "Hef asked me to be one of his girlfriends and live in the mansion and I was like, 'I don't even know what that means, but hell, yeah! I'm there!' I was living in this small-ass apartment. … I was praying for anything to get me out of there."
But did Wilkinson know that sex with the master of the mansion was essentially a prerequisite to living there? "I moved in and weeks went by and I didn't know that sex was involved," she said. "Because I knew nothing about Playboy. I had just graduated high school." When the time came, Hefner didn't mince words, asking Wilkinson if she "want[ed] to come upstairs," Wilkinson recalled. When Sykes, 44, asked whether Kendra would have been shown the door if her answer had been no, Wilkinson hemmed and hawed, telling I'm a Celebrity cameras that Hef "really looks at them as real relationships." In other words, sex equals relationship equals mansion. As it was, her relationship with Hefner ended in 2008 after her engagement to Hank Baskett, whom she wed in 2009. Since then, the couple's marital woes following Baskett's alleged affair have been playing out on Kendra on Top and Marriage Boot Camp.

 


Kendra Wilkinson Says She's Never Divorcing Hank Baskett

 Love conquers all – even an alleged dalliance with a transexual model. Kendra Wilkinson told Access Hollywood Live Friday that she and Hank Baskett will remain married, despite having considered whether to dump her husband of five years for allegedly cheating with a transexual model. "He loves me and we're gonna be together for the rest of our lives," she said on the syndicated show. "We'll prove it ... until we're 100 years old. We're gonna be together forever."Anyone watching Kendra on Top on WE tv right now would think Wilkinson, 29, was on the brink of leaving Baskett, 32. Last week's episode, for example, featured Wilkinson confronting her estranged husband in his apartment and saying, "We're not married right now. I'm not your wife." In a previous episode, she's seen throwing a tantrum and telling Baskett he isn't wanted.  On Access Hollywood Live, however, Wilkinson changes her tune by saying Baskett "got trapped" in a scandal and he's really "an innocent, vulnerable guy. It's so sad." "It's not what you think happened," she told the morning show. "I can't go on further past that. There is some investigation going on right now and that's why I have to stay away from some things."

"We are on the road to recovery," Wilkinson continued. "We are on the road to friendship again. I believe that our marriage has been shaken up and I believe that this is something that is gonna renew us … as people, renew us as friends. There are curveballs that are thrown at you and you just have to get over it and forgive." "If you believe you're perfect and you don't believe in forgiveness, you're not meant to be married," she added. "He went through an identity crisis."

Despite having spent years living in the Playboy mansion as the girlfriend of Hugh Hefner, nothing could have prepared Kendra Wilkinson for tonight's Bushtucker Trial.
Bushtucker trials are performed by I'm a Celebrity... Get Me Out of Here contestants to win food and treats for camp. Eating trials require contestants to eat foods such as crickets, spiders and other insects. Physical and mental tasks have included working through obstacle courses and tunnels.

Why HOT Kim Kardashian is trending today

Another a nice way to get attention from social media…is she a role models for young mothers?
Her millions-strong popularity and inescapable media presence have made her grist for think pieces galore. She is variously seen as a feminist-entrepreneur-pop-culture-icon or a late-stage symptom of our society's myriad ills: narcissism, opportunism, unbridled ambition, unchecked capitalism. But behind all the hoopla, there is an actual woman -- a physical body where the forces of fame and wealth converge. Who isn't at least a tad curious about the flesh that carries the myth?
kkcover1(rgb)watermark.jpg
Unlike most people, she looks exactly the same in person as she does in photographs or on television, with one exception: she is smaller than she appears in images, with tiny, almost doll-like ears and feet and hands. Everything else about her seems amplified, tumescent. Her black hair is thicker than any you have ever seen, her lips fuller, her giant Bambi-eyes larger, their whites whiter, and the lashes that frame them longer. If some of this is the result of artificial enhancement -- does anyone else have eyelashes that resemble miniature feather dusters? -- none of it seems obviously ersatz. But that's not to say it looks real, either. She is like a beautiful anime character come to life. As soon as she arrives at the hostess podium of the Polo Lounge in Beverly Hills, where we meet for our interview, a young fan who appears to be in her late teens or early twenties accosts her. The fan has been running to catch (keep up with?) Kardashian; she brings with her a breeze. "Will you take a selfie with me, Kim?" she pants. (This is what fans asks the High Priestess of Instagram -- autographs are so last century.) She obliges, leaning in for the picture and striding away almost before I can blink. "She's gonna post it," Kardashian says wryly. "I bet it's posted right now." Later, she will tell me that she's "not really a filter person," and that she doesn't generally use them when she publishes her many selfies. As she talks, I notice that her skin, which is the golden color of whiskey, is free of wrinkles, crow's feet, laugh lines, blemishes, freckles, moles, under-eye circles, scars, errant eyebrow hairs or human flaws of any kind. It's like she comes with a built-in filter of her own.
 kkmiddle(rgb)watermark.jpg
With its enveloping green leather booths and twinkling white garden lights, the Polo Lounge is a setting that lends itself to intimacy. Kardashian, who is wearing a monochromatic champagne-colored ensemble (Margiela bodysuit, Chloé silk pants, Lanvin silk coat), gives off a cozy vibe herself. She leans forward while she talks, resting her cheek in the palm of her hand as though she's chatting with her closest girlfriend. She tells me that the Kardashian clan is currently a week into filming season 10 of Keeping Up With the Kardashians, which she has called "the best family movie ever," never mind the rampant speculation, in early 2013, that season 9 would be her last. I'm surprised to hear that they still enjoy the process, since your typical American family would no longer be on speaking terms. "We're kind of obsessed with each other," she explains.

Today, a day off, she spent at a pumpkin patch with West, whom she repeatedly calls Kanye -- she clearly enjoys saying his name -- and their 16-month old daughter, North. They arrived at the farm unbothered by photographers, a rarity in the circus that is her life ("literally every single day there's about ten cars of paparazzi literally waiting outside our homes"). It wasn't long, however, before the paparazzi had surrounded them. "I couldn't really pick out our pumpkins, and [North] couldn't really enjoy it," she says. After a moment, perhaps concerned that she has come perilously close to complaining about her fame, she adds matter-of-factly: "You just have to not care. You just have to say, 'This is our life, and it is what it is.'" Her delivery is Zen-like, almost affectless, as it is on the show. "All my friends tell me the world could be coming to an end, and I'm always so calm," she says, opening a packet of Equal. She empties its contents into a glass of passion fruit iced tea, then fastidiously bites granules of sweetener off her manicured nails.

kkcover2(rgb)watermark.jpg
The rap on Kim Kardashian is that she has done nothing to merit her fame. But the longer I steep myself in the ambience of her pleasantly languid manner and hologram-perfect looks, the more facile this charge begins to seem. Of course, she has cannily leveraged that fame to build, with her sisters, a beauty-industrial complex, which includes a clothing line, a makeup line, a line of tanning products and seven perfumes. (A collection of hair care implements and styling products will debut in the spring.) Her mobile app, Kim Kardashian: Hollywood, in which players climb their way to A-List status under Kardashian's tutelage, has earned over $43 million since its debut in June.

Yet her perceived lack of accomplishment is also, perhaps, an accomplishment in itself. Kardashian seems to know instinctively that, as Andy Warhol once observed, "When you just see somebody on the street, they can really have an aura. But then when they open their mouth, there goes the aura." Take the stream of small faux-confidences that she offers during the interview. They reveal very little yet foster a sense of closeness. She tells me that she is "obsessed with apps" but, when I ask her to name one, she replies, "I like all different apps." Of her 72-day marriage to Kris Humphries, one of her rare missteps that actually left a footprint, she says: "It's just one of those life lessons that you have to learn, and it's OK." Her behavior suggests that the key to total ubiquity is giving up all of one's verbal edges and sharp angles (while occasionally tossing out a memorable visual flare: a sex tape, say, or a nude photo shoot).

Social media has created a new kind of fame, and Kardashian is its paragon. It is a fame whose hallmark is agreeable omnipresence, which resembles a kind of evenly spread absence, soothing, tranquil and unobjectionable. There's an argument to be made that Kardashian has been recorded and viewed more often than any other personage in history, and while she has certainly had her awkward moments (posting a vampire facial on Instagram, announcing that she wanted to buy a stroller that complemented her unborn baby's skin color), she has also never made a truly ruinous gaffe, been caught in a Britney Spears-style public meltdown or sallied forth looking less than photogenic. As she puts it, "There's nothing we can do that's not documented, so why not look your best, and amazing?"

To mere mortals who occasionally visit the grocery store in yoga pants, her willpower and self-discipline are a marvel. Imagine being filmed and photographed constantly, yet never saying anything seriously controversial or appearing unkempt. The effort involved seems torturous, impossible. And yet, though her life requires work of a sort -- roughly two hours of hair and makeup each day, regular meetings for her assorted businesses, wardrobe fittings, photo shoots, 5:00 a.m. workouts -- you don't get the sense that she is hiding or suppressing her true, private self. "I think you've seen every side of me on my show," she says, popping a piece of pound cake into her mouth. We're accustomed to our performers having onstage and backstage registers, but for her there is no division between the two. This is, indeed, the definition of a reality star. She's not performing, that is -- at least not visibly. She is being, and being is her act. Her appeal derives from her uncanny consistency, as does that of her show. It's relaxing to watch the sisters sprawl on each other's beds and talk about nothing, to see them discuss constipation cures or their preferred way to eat Nilla Wafers. Like Warhol's screen tests, Keeping up with the Kardashians has a disarming purity. It invites us to glory in its stars' mundanity, which permits us to enjoy our own.

Who is Chelsea Handler?

Chelsea was born in Livingston, New Jersey, the youngest of six children of Rita (née Stoecker), a homemaker, and Seymour Handler, a used car dealer Her American father is Jewish; her German-born mother, who came to the United States in 1958, was a Mormon Handler was raised in Reform Judaism and had a Bat Mitzvah ceremony. She has said that while growing up she felt like an outsider, recalling, "We lived in this nice Jewish neighborhood...Everyone had Mercedes and Jaguars, and I was going to school in a Pinto.



Can You Handle VMA Host Chelsea Handler?
In a June 2011 episode of her show, she and author James Van Praagh discussed the death of her brother, Chet, when she was 9 years old. Handler had an abortion at age 16, which she discussed during an interview in 2011.] At age 19, she moved from New Jersey to Los Angeles, California, to pursue an acting career, and two years later, became a stand-up comic after telling her story about a DUI to a class of other offenders, who found it funny.

She is always creating controversies this it is different kind. Chelsea Handler had herself a very busy Thursday night. The comedian took to Instagram to post a photo of herself topless while riding a horse, juxtaposing this racy image with a similar photo made famous by Russian President Vladimir Putin. "Anything a man can do, a woman has the right to do better. #kremlin," Handler captioned the picture.


Cee-Lo Green visited ‘Chelsea Lately’ Wednesday night, and Chelsea ...

But Instagram quickly removed the image, citing its policy on nudity, which only incensed the lewd talk show host. "If a man posts a photo of his nipples, it's ok, but not a woman? Are we in 1825?" Handler wrote in another Instagram message. Handler then re-published the nude photo on Twitter and wrote along with it: "Taking this down is sexist. I have every right to show I have a better body than Putin."
The comedian, of course, is no stranger to getting naked on social media. In August, she stripped down on Instagram to mock the Kardashians. She's also taken naked showers on her E! talk show with Sandra Bullock and with Conan O'Brien, among others.Late last night, meanwhile, she added the racy picture to Instagram a second time, daring the website to violate her First Amendment rights. "If instagram takes this down again, you're saying Vladimir Putin Has more 1st amendment rights than me. Talk to your bosses,” she wrote. So Instagram went ahead and yanked down the photo a second time... then reinstated it... and then deleted it a third time, all within an hour. Handler will debut a new talk show on Netflix in October 2016, but it's never too early to start making some headlines for it, right?
